MEMPHIS, Tenn. - A weak system Monday could bring a few spotty showers this afternoon and evening, with only about a 20% percent chance of rain. Otherwise, skies will be partly to mostly cloudy with highs in the low to mid 80s.

As we head into Monday tonight and Tuesday, rain chances fade and a much cooler, drier airmass settles in. Overnight lows will drop into the upper 50s to mid 60s by sunrise.

Tuesday and Wednesday will bring our first real taste of fall. Expect sunny, dry skies with highs only in the upper 70s to near 80 and morning lows dipping into the 50s. Some record lows could be tied or broken Wednesday morning.
